H3: Are cheaper cars safer or less reliable?
Not at all. Modern rental fleets serve diverse travel needs, including compact and economy models built for safety and fuel efficiency. Reputable agencies ensure vehicles are well-maintained, insured, and compliant with state regulations—no compromises on quality.

The process starts with location and timing. Sticking to off-airport or secondary pickup points often lowers base rates by 15–25%. Booking directly through a rental provider’s app or loyalty program unlocks member discounts, while flexible dates and mid-week rentals frequently unlock lower weekly rates. Late-night returns or avoiding peak seasons like summer holidays also reduce costs. Choosing economy or compact cars suited to short daily drives further enhances savings. When paired with fuel management strategies and local insurance planning, these steps create a predictable, budget-friendly car rental experience widely accessible to travelers across the US.

The main opportunity lies in shifting travel strategy to lower-cost windows, opting for self-pickup with advance booking, and combining rental cars with public transit in urban hubs. Travelers should weigh parking fees in the city core, insurance inclusions, and local tolls. While savings of $100–$300 per week are achievable with disciplined planning, overspending habits or last-minute bookings can erode benefits. Factoring in real-world usage avoids the common trap of expecting instant savings without preparation. For multi-day stays, road trips, or group travel, rentals deliver unmatched flexibility.
